Lonesome Creek flood & bushfire risk
Of Lonesome Creek’s 376 mapped properties, 100% are in a mapped flood area and 15.7% are in a bushfire hazard area.
For context, Lonesome Creek’s flood exposure is above the QLD average of 49.9%, and bushfire exposure is in line with the QLD average of 17.2%.

Crime near Lonesome Creek
Lonesome Creek sits in the Theodore police division, which recorded 69 reported offences in the 12 months to Jun 2026.

Who lives in Lonesome Creek
At the 2021 Census, 1.2% of Lonesome Creek’s 173 residents were born overseas.

Development near Lonesome Creek
Banana council approved 31 new dwellings in the 12 months to May 2026.
